Southern Brazil, particularly Rio Grande do Sul, is facing catastrophic floods leading to a rise in crime, looting, and evacuation of over half a million residents. The floods have also affected neighboring countries like Argentina and Uruguay. The Guaíba River in Porto Alegre has risen significantly, causing severe damage and disruptions, including the closure of the airport for months.
